Warburtons in Stone is looking for a Class 2 Multi-Drop Driver. You will load your own vehicle and deliver baked goods to multiple customers, ensuring top-notch service. The role offers a 6-week induction and emphasizes autonomy with delivery notes to guide your tasks.
Weekly pay is £767.97, along with profit shares, a pension scheme, and continued investment in your development. Join a company that champions diversity and creates an inclusive workplace for all.
